英文摘要
Control of Flowering is a dream of farmers. Especially in fruit trees, juvenile phase (the time between sowing and first flowering) is generally long. In the case of Citrus species, this period is more than 8 years. Therefore, to shorten this period is important for the cultivation of these trees. FLOWERING LOCUS T (FT) protein is the most potent candidate of flowering hormone "florigen". To reduce the juvenile phase of Citrus species, we directly injected bacterially-expressed FT protein into these plants. Although we sometimes seceeded to induce the flowering, we did not always do it. Alternatively, we searched the chemical inhibitors against the flowering inhibitor TFL1 protein. However, these attempts were failed
